Food in San Pedro tells the story of Ambergris Caye itself. This small island community has grown from a fishing village into a destination that draws visitors from around the world, and the restaurants here reflect that blend of local roots and cosmopolitan influences. Whether you’re after humble street food or sit-down dining, the best restaurants in San Pedro offer genuine flavors rather than tourist shortcuts.

The island’s location at the edge of the world’s second-largest barrier reef means seafood dominates menus, but there’s depth here beyond just fish. You’ll find Creole traditions alive in family-run establishments, Maya heritage in certain dishes, and Caribbean techniques woven through kitchens large and small. Many restaurant owners have been feeding locals and visitors for decades, which tells you something about consistency and care.

Restaurants to try during your SunBreeze Stay

Apart from Jambel’s at SunBreeze Suites, San Pedro has a solid dining scene worth exploring during your stay. Here are some of the restaurants worth making time for.

Blue Water Grill sits right on the beach and is one of the most reliably good options in town, open for breakfast, lunch and dinner every day. On Tuesday and Friday evenings they run a sushi menu alongside their regular dinner specials — a good option if you are after something a little different.

El Fogon is where locals go for traditional Belizean cooking. Many of the dishes are prepared over an open wood fire in a traditional hearth, which comes through in the flavour. It is a little off the main drag but worth finding. Open for lunch and dinner, closed Sundays.

Elvi’s Kitchen has been on the island longer than any other restaurant and still serves some of the best traditional Belizean food in San Pedro. Open for lunch and dinner, closed Sundays.

Caliente is a relaxed lagoon-side spot serving Mexican and Belizean dishes. Family friendly and well known for Friday night margarita prices. Open for lunch and dinner, closed Mondays.

Caramba runs a buffet of Mexican and Belizean dishes and is a good choice for a casual, filling meal. Open for lunch and dinner, closed Wednesdays.

Waraguma on Back Street is a local favourite for pupusas and seafood burritos. Straightforward, good value and open every day for lunch and dinner.

Maxie’s Restaurant and Lounge is a newer addition on Back Street serving breakfast, lunch and dinner from 9:30am. Open until 10pm Sunday through Thursday and midnight on weekends.

Purple Pelican is a fine dining spot built on the lagoon, worth booking for an evening out. Open Wednesday through Monday from 4pm, closed Tuesdays.

South of town, La Palmilla at Victoria House two miles south is the island’s most elegant dining option, open daily for all three meals. Hidden Treasure, also two miles south, offers a romantic dinner setting and can arrange complimentary transport through Guest Services — open from 5pm, closed Tuesdays. The Deck is a relaxed beachfront seafood spot 1.5 miles south, open for lunch and dinner daily.

North of town, Truck Stop one mile north is a shipping container food park and beer garden with pizza, Malaysian and South American food, a lagoon dock for sunsets and a lively atmosphere. Fun for families and open from noon, closed Mondays and Tuesdays. Aji Tapa Bar and Restaurant 2.5 miles north serves Spanish and Belizean food in an open-air jungle beach setting, open for dinner from 5pm, closed Tuesdays. Garage Bar and Grill one mile north covers seafood, steaks and Belizean and American dishes, open for dinner from 5pm, closed Mondays.

The restaurant scene in San Pedro has matured without losing its soul. What you’re eating often comes from within a few miles, prepared by people who’ve been doing it for years. The best restaurants in San Pedro aren’t defined by price point or concept. They’re defined by consistency, ingredient quality, and the kind of hospitality that comes from actually caring about the food and the people who eat it. After a day in and around the island, sitting down at one of these tables feels like a proper way to understand the place.
